How Inlets and Overland Flow Junctions work in InfoSWMM

The overland flow junction does have an invert and rim elevation, it is usually part of a road system and you can drain Subcatchment flow to the overland flow junction.   If an Inlet node is flooded the excess water can flow out of the inlet to the street through the overland flow junction.  There is a virtual link between the Inlet Junction and the Overland Flow Junction.
